That’s the vision behind Copilot, Microsoft’s new AI platform that aims to democratize AI and make it accessible to everyone.
Copilot is an everyday AI companion that can understand natural language, reason over data, and generate content using advanced models like ChatGPT and GPT-4.
In his annual letter to shareholders, Microsoft CEO Satya Nadella shared how Copilot is being integrated into Microsoft’s products and services, as well as how customers and partners are using it to achieve more.
Copilot in Microsoft Products and Services
Microsoft is building Copilot into all its most used products and experiences, such as:
Azure AI: The cloud platform that offers the best selection of industry-leading and open models, including ChatGPT and GPT-4, as well as tools to customize and deploy them safely.
GitHub Copilot: The AI-powered code completion tool that helps developers write code faster and better, with more than 27,000 organizations using it for business.
Power Platform: The low-code/no-code toolchain that enables domain experts to automate workflows, create apps and webpages, build virtual agents, or analyze data using natural language.
Dynamics 365: The business application suite that helps employees across every function and line of business with Copilot features like content generation, notetaking, and supply chain optimization.
Microsoft 365: The productivity platform that enables every individual to amplify their creativity and productivity with Copilot features like predictive text, intelligent meeting recaps, and employee engagement insights.
Bing and Microsoft Edge: The search engine and browser that bring together search, browsing, chat, and AI into one unified experience to deliver better search results, more complete answers, a new chat experience, and the ability to generate content.
LinkedIn: The professional network that helps people connect, learn, sell, and get hired with Copilot features like AI-powered articles, skills assessments, and job recommendations.
Xbox Game Pass: The gaming service that redefines how games are distributed, played, and viewed with Copilot features like personalized recommendations, social interactions, and content creation.
Windows 11: The operating system that turns Windows into a powerful new AI canvas with Copilot features that incorporate the context and intelligence of the web, work data, and user activity to provide better assistance.
Copilot in Customer and Partner Solutions
Microsoft’s customers and partners are also using Copilot to create innovative solutions across industries and scenarios. Some examples are:
Epic: The leading electronic health records vendor that is addressing some of the biggest challenges facing the healthcare industry today—including physician burnout—by deploying a wide range of copilot solutions built on Azure OpenAI Service and Dragon Ambient eXperience Copilot.
Mercado Libre: The e-commerce giant that is reducing the time its developers spend writing code by more than 50 percent with GitHub Copilot, as it works to democratize e-commerce across Latin America.
Mercedes-Benz: The luxury car maker that is making its in-car voice assistant more intuitive for hundreds of thousands of drivers using ChatGPT via the Azure OpenAI Service.
Lumen Technologies: The communications company that is helping its employees be more productive by enabling them to focus on higher value-added activities with Microsoft 365 Copilot.
The Contingent: The nonprofit organization that is matching foster families with children in need using Dynamics 365, Power BI, and Azure, with an eye on using AI to amplify its work across the US.
Taiwan’s Ministry of Education: The government agency that has built an online platform to help elementary and high school students learn English using Azure AI.
